Company Members
Arabian Dance Theatre is a collective of around 20 performers. The 3 main organisers of the company are:
Shafeek Ibrahim – Artistic Director & Choreographer
 |
Shafeek Ibrahim was born in Egypt and is a master of Arabian Dance Arts. Shafeek started to learn dance from a young age and by the time he was 16 was working as a professional dancer in theatre productions and dance companies touring all over Egypt. Shafeek was also a member the Reda Troup, Egypt’s very prestigious national folklore dance troupe. At the age of just 21 Shafeek moved to the UK and he quickly became an Internationally renowned dance teacher, performer and choreographer. In his 12 years dancing career he has performed for film, TV and theatre productions in the UK and Egypt as well as abroad. Shafeek is the artistic director and main choreographer of the Arabian Dance Theatre company. |
Tara Lee Oakley – Founder
 |
Tara has been involved in Arabic Dance Arts for the last 10 years. She first became introduced to Arabic dance and culture whilst at University studying electives in Arabic Media. Her passion for dance developed rapidly and quickly became a full time commitment. She has now worked as a professional Arabic dance artist performing across the UK as well as internationally for 10 years. Tara has worked as a performer in Egypt, Morocco, Anu Dhabi, Palestine and Lebanon. She became interested in theatre art whilst working in Egypt performing dance in 2 major theatre productions, in Cairo and in Sharm. Tara is involved in the total creation and public presentation of Arabian Dance Theatre productions. |
Isa Randle – Dance Captain
 |
Isa has trained in in ballet, jazz, various commercial dance styles, contemporary dance, singing and acting at one of London’s top performing arts schools. After refining her art as a performer she landed a role in the West End musical “CATS.” Isa has many years of professional dance experience and has appeared in film, television and theatre productions. She has performed for MTV, MOBO and BRIT Awards as well as BBC, ITV and Channel 4. She has performed all over the world and has worked and toured with famous acts such as “Kylie Minoque”, “Destiny’s Child”, and “Robbie Williams.” Isa has been learning Raqs Sharqi and Arabian folk dance with Shafeek since 2007 and it has become a major passion. |
